The Power of Delusion: The Irrational Psychology of Superstition, Ritualism, and Overoptimism [Chinese]

According to the definition of the American Psychiatric Association, delusion is "a persistent belief that cannot be changed despite sufficient evidence to refute it." Although severe delusion is a disease, in life, we rely on a moderate degree of delusion to overcome difficulties, achieve goals, and get through low points, and it is even an indispensable habit in life. Whether it's the President of the United States or a private citizen, everyone has their own unique rituals and irrational beliefs to help them stabilize their moods and stand their ground. It's a good way of thinking as long as it helps to achieve a goal. Rationality and logic are just a few of the many survival tools available to mankind, and sometimes we have to let our intuition and emotions take over. The goal of this book is to remind readers that we are all complex human beings, and the only way to realize a more complete life is to find a balance between reality and fantasy, optimism and pessimism.
